Transaction 169952686ae061ab489938c68430132702a9350ea5574c817c91eaab68374c8f

1 Input
2 Outputs
  • 169952686ae061ab489938c68430132702a9350ea5574c817c91eaab68374c8f:0
  • value  1000000
    address  2NDQSyyLMRazgB9D7RTmNyR9CTUPfVLCJKQ
  • 169952686ae061ab489938c68430132702a9350ea5574c817c91eaab68374c8f:1
  • value  7199834
    address  2Mufwq2iFYXY6gBxH3HC4wzdACtaDF3sWoz